Two people arrested following burglary in Kansas

KANSAS — Two men from Johnson County were arrested late Sunday night in connection with a burglary at an abandoned property in Eskridge, according to the Wabaunsee County Sheriff’s Office.

On May 26, 2025, Sergeant Williams observed a suspicious gray 2018 Hyundai Tucson circling a structure on the 200 block of South Cedar without headlights before parking.

Two individuals dressed in black exited the vehicle and entered the vacant building with bags, later seen loading items into the vehicle.

As the suspects attempted to leave the area, Sergeant Williams initiated a traffic stop. The driver was identified as 18-year-old Zane Arthur Burnett and the passenger as 19-year-old Eli Joseph Hoskins.

A probable cause search of the vehicle uncovered stolen property from the building, including Masonic books, antique photographs, and other items in wet, dirt-covered bags.

Both men were arrested without incident and transported to the Wabaunsee County Jail. They remain in custody pending bond on burglary charges.

Authorities remind the public that all suspects are presumed innocent until proven guilty in a court of law.
